Texas will extend time that schools will be allowed to stay online-only, Gov. Greg Abbott says

Aliyya Swaby and Patrick Svitek | Texas Tribune
Posted 7/14/20

Schools had previously been told that they would need to limit online-only instruction to the first three weeks of the school year, or they'd lose state funding.
